1、Selecting Your Winter Scarf
The first step is to choose the right scarf for the job. Winter scarves come in a variety of materials, colors, and styles, so it’s important to select one that suits your needs and personal style.
For example, a wool scarf will provide more warmth than a lighter-weight cotton scarf. If you’re looking for something more stylish, consider a silk or cashmere scarf.
2、Wrapping Your Winter Scarf
Once you’ve selected your scarf, it’s time to wrap it around your neck. There are several ways to do this, so feel free to experiment until you find the style that suits you best.
a. Basic Wrap: This is the most common way to wear a scarf. Simply loop one end of the scarf around your neck and tuck the other end into the loop. Adjust the size of the loop to fit comfortably around your neck.
b. The Double Wrap: If you want extra warmth, try wrapping the scarf around your neck twice. Simply loop one end of the scarf around your neck, then bring the other end back around and tuck it into the first loop.
c. The Knot: Another common way to wear a scarf is to tie it in a knot. Bring both ends of the scarf around your neck and cross them in front of your chest. Then, take each end and loop it through the opposite side’s loop, pulling it tight to secure the knot.
d. The Plunging Wrap: For a more dramatic look, try the plunging wrap. Loop one end of the scarf around your neck and let the other end hang down in front of you. Then, take the end that’s hanging down and loop it around your neck again, this time crossing it in front of your neckline.
3、Materials and Care
The material your scarf is made from will determine how often and how you should wash it. For example, wool scarves should be hand-washed in cool water with a mild detergent, while synthetic scarves can be machine-washed on a delicate cycle.
In addition, be sure to store your scarf properly when not in use. Hang it on a hanger or lay it flat in a drawer to prevent creasing or stretching.
4、Matching Your Winter Scarf
Your scarf should complement your outfit, not overshadow it. If you’re wearing a bright winter coat, for example, pair it with a neutral-colored scarf like black or gray to avoid looking too matchy-matchy.
Similarly, if you’re wearing a dark winter coat, opt for a brightly colored scarf like red or blue to add a pop of color to your ensemble.
